Fantastic, one more smelly bastard.

Kidding aside, you're like a suburban mom with a dessert menu with these upgrades. The key to mastering CSM is to decide which units need redundancy, and which ones need to take which upgrades, because THERE ARE SO MANY UPGRADES HOLY GAMES WORKSHOP.

Your Lord is basically a 3-wound sergeant. Give him tactical use or combat use, or just take him bare bones because 1 HQ is required and you need to make your PMs troops.

Don't take a full initiative weapon on your PM sergeant. Hes attacking last anyway so just give him a power axe or fist.

BY FAR your biggest point sink here is your 5 CSM. You're paying for PMs, take them.

Raptors are outdone in about everything by bikes

take the oblits as 3 solo oblits.
